certamen.

contest, competition; battle, combat, struggle; rivalry; (matter in) dispute;

Meaning & usage

noun[kɛrˈtaː.mɛn]Classical-Latin[t͡ʃerˈtaː.men]
  1. A contest, race, struggle, strife.

    declension-3
  2. A battle, engagement, combat.

    declension-3
  3. An object contended for, prize.

    declension-3
Where this word comes from

Etymology tree Latin certō Proto-Indo-European *-mn̥ Proto-Italic *-mn̥ Latin -men Latin certāmen From certō (“struggle, contend”) + -men (noun-forming suffix).
